Thirteen killed, 60 injured in multi-vehicle crash on Yamuna Expressway in Uttar Pradesh amid fog.
A multi-vehicle collision on the Yamuna Expressway near Mathura, Uttar Pradesh, on December 16, 2025, killed at least 13 people and injured 60, with fires breaking out after several buses and cars collided in dense fog.
The accident, which occurred around 4:30 a.m. near Milestone 127, prompted a four-hour rescue operation involving 14 fire tenders, after which traffic was restored.
Prime Minister Narendra Modi and Uttar Pradesh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ath expressed condolences, with both announcing ex-gratia payments of ₹2 lakh to families of the deceased and ₹50,000 to each injured person.
Authorities are using DNA testing to identify victims, as the official body count remains pending the completion of the panchnama.
